Kidney Health Under High Protein Consumption: Facts and Fiction
The belief that high-protein diets can adversely affect kidney health is widespread. Many individuals hold onto this myth due to early research suggesting a link between protein intake and kidney strain. However, this notion has been challenged by more recent findings that demonstrate protein consumption does not universally lead to kidney damage in healthy individuals. The kidneys are remarkably resilient organs, capable of adapting to increased protein intake without adverse effects. Studies have shown that, in healthy adults, the consumption of increased protein does not significantly harm kidney function over time. It’s important to differentiate between individuals with pre-existing kidney conditions and those with healthy kidneys. For the latter group, moderate to high protein diets can be beneficial in various aspects of health, such as promoting muscle mass. However, those with existing kidney disease may need to monitor their protein intake carefully. Consulting with healthcare professionals is essential for personalized dietary recommendations. One popular argument against high-protein diets asserts that they lead to higher levels of urea and other nitrogenous waste products in the bloodstream. While this may sound concerning, the body efficiently manages these byproducts through the kidneys. In healthy individuals, the kidneys accommodate increased workload without any detrimental outcomes. Furthermore, sources of protein can be varied; they include animal products, legumes, and dairy. Understanding Protein Needs
Determining how much protein an individual needs is contingent upon various factors, including age, sex, weight, and activity level. For most adults, dietary recommendations suggest about 0.8 grams of protein per kilogram of body weight per day. Athletes or those engaging in vigorous exercise might require between 1.2 to 2.0 grams per kilogram to support muscle recovery and growth. Considering these values can help in crafting a personalized dietary plan. Additionally, special considerations must be given to unique populations, such as pregnant women or the elderly, who may need slightly different protein intakes.
